1825 Cooper Point Rd SW, Olympia, WA 98502
Auto Mall Mini Storage is a self storage facility in Olympia, WA located at 1825 Cooper Point Rd SW, Olympia, WA 98502. Auto Mall Mini Storage offers affordable, convenient self storage units in Olympia, WA.